Manatee High School is a State/Public serving high age pupils, located in Bradenton, Manatee County. The school has 1,983 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Manatee school district. It serves grades 9โ12 in an urban setting. The school employs 91 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 21.8:1. 47% of students are proficient in reading. 32% are proficient in maths. The four-year graduation rate is 86%. The school offers 10 AP courses, dual enrollment, a gifted and talented program.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.
Manatee High School enrolls 1,983 students across grades 9โ12. The student body is 50% male and 50% female. A teaching staff of 91 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 21.8: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 44% White, 37% Hispanic or Latino and 14% Black or African American.

1,173 of the school's 1,983 students (59%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 1,053 qualify for free lunch and 120 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Manatee High School is located in an urban setting (NCES locale: City, Small).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district FL At-Large (non-voting delegate), state senate district 21, state house district 71.
Manatee High School is one of 81 schools in MANATEE, based in BRADENTON, Florida. The district serves 54,215 students district-wide and employs 2,963 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 1,983 students, Manatee High School is larger than the district average of about 669 students per school.
